I used Unity Stamp's Hauntingly Sweet set and embossed with black embossing powder before coloring those lil' punkins and candy corn. The background is white cardstock dry embossed with the spiderweb embossing folder from Stampin' Up!, I then spritzed it with Tattered Angels sparkly spray then sponged some black ink to highlight the web a little better. The picture doesn't show them very well but there are 3 black rhinestones in the top left corner...had to add a little bling! Sooooo fun!!!! I might have used just a tad too much of that fun spritz. We began our weekend by eating dinner at Royer's Round Top Cafe--where they are famous for their pies. And lemme tell you....oooohhhheemmmmgeeeee FREAKIN' GOOOOOD.  I knew I was going to take home a whole Chocolate Chip Pie (OMGx6!!!) so decided to eat a slice of Buttermilk Deluxe Pie--which has coconut and chocolate chips in it. All their pies are served with a scoop of AMY'S ICE CREAM which OMG is the BESTEST ICE CREAM ON THE PLANET (sorry, Blue Bell, you're a close 2nd).  Royer's actually CHARGES you 50 cents if you want your pie WITHOUT ice cream!
